PostgreSQL啓動過程中的那些事七:初始化共享內存和信號十七:shmem中初始化AutoVacuum相關結構...

這一節pg初始化AutoVacuum系統和進程用到的相關結構,通過AutoVacuumShmemInit例程實現。主要是初始化了一個AutoVacuumShmemStruct結構和autovacuum_max_workers個(默認3個,可以根據GUC參數設置)結構組成的鏈表,以供AutoVacuum相關進程使用。 AutoVacuum系統架構於兩種不同的進程:autovacuum發起者進程(la
相關文章
相關標籤/搜索